Navigating Fabric Challenges and Stitch Density

While the design is robust, it is not immune to the physics of embroidery. If you plan to use Funny SVG, I m Not for Everyone SVG, PNG on different substrates, you must exercise caution. For instance, applying this to a stretchy knit fabric for a t-shirt requires a heavy-duty stabilizer. Without proper support, the tension from the stitches can cause the fabric to pucker, distorting the message. Similarly, if you attempt this on a textured fabric like a wool blend or a thick fleece, the thread may sink into the fibers, reducing the clarity of the text.

Another area requiring attention is the hoop size. While the design seems compact, always verify the dimensions before starting. If you are working with a small hoop, such as a 4x4 inch frame, you might need to resize the design carefully. Shrinking the file too much can lead to issues with stitch density, causing threads to bunch up or break. Conversely, stretching it too large might reveal gaps in the fill areas. Always test the design on scrap fabric first. This simple step saves hours of frustration and prevents ruining expensive materials.
